body{
font-family: 'Rubik', sans-serif;
background-color:#ffffff;
overflow-x:hidden;
}

a:link {
    color:#32a7c9;
    text-decoration: none;
}

a:visited {
    color:#32a7c9;
}

a:hover {
    color:#ff6a4c;
}

a:active {
    color:#fff;
}

.navbar{
  background-color:#ffffff;
  overflow:hidden;
  height:40px;
}

.navbar a{
  float:left;
  display:block;
  color:#000;
  text-align:center;
  padding:0px 16px;
  text-decoration:none;
  font-size:36px;
}

.navbar ul{
  margin:8px 0 0 0;
  list-style:none;
}

.navbar a:hover{
  background-color:#ff6a4c;
  color:#fff;
}

.side-nav{
  height:100%;
  width:0;
  position:fixed;
  z-index:1;
  top:0;
  left:0;
  background-color:#dbab1b;
  opacity:1;
  overflow-x:hidden;
  padding-top:60px;
  transition:0.5s;
}

.side-nav a{
  padding:10px 10px 10px 30px;
  text-decoration:none;
  font-size:22px;
  color:#ffffff;
  display:block;
  transition:0.3s;
}

.side-nav a:hover{
  color:#ff6a4c;
}

.side-nav .btn-close{
  position:absolute;
  top:0;
  right:22px;
  font-size:36px;
  margin-left:50px;
}

.purple{
    background-color: #9b44e4;
    color: #fff;
}

.blue{
    background-color: #32a7c9;
    color: #fff;
}

#main{
  transition:margin-left 0.5s;
  padding-top:10px;
  padding-left: 20px;
  padding-right: 20px;
  padding-bottom: 20px;
  overflow:hidden;
  width:90%;
  
}

h1{
  display: block;
  font-size: 4em;
  margin-top: 0px;
  margin-bottom: 0px;
  margin-left: 0px;
  margin-right: 0px;
  font-weight: bold;    
}

h2{
  display: block;
  font-size: 1.5em;
  margin-top: 0px;
  margin-bottom: 0px;
  margin-left: 0;
  margin-right: 0;
  font-weight: bold;    
}

p{
  font-size: 1em;  
}

.profile-img{
    width: 100%;
    max-width: 400px;
}

.body-txt{
    width: 90%;
    max-width: 800px;
    
}

#mapid {
    height: 500px;
}

@media(max-width:568px){
  .navbar-nav{display:none}
}